[patch 3/10] s390: deadlock in dasd_devmap.

From: Horst Hummel <horst.hummel@de.ibm.com>

Reintroduce a read-only copy of the devmap features in the
device struct. This is necessary to solve a deadlock on
the dasd_devmap_lock which is acquired by dasd_get_features
called from the dasd tasklet. The current implementation of
devmap doesn't allow to call any devmap function from
interrupt or softirq context.
